A student asked a simple question in one of our Surface Modeling classes: "How do you convert a spline to lines?"
The resulted tech tip solves several long-standing challenges in SOLIDWORKS—without relying on macros:
✅ Parametrically convert any entity or chain of sketch entities into linear segments, with full control over deviation from the original curve.
✅ Offset complex sketches with virtually no limitations on the offset value.
✅ Robust updates that adapt seamlessly, even after major revisions to the original geometry.
